This advanced test specifically targets the ETFB gene, which plays a critical role in the electron transfer flavoprotein complex essential for fatty acid oxidation and energy metabolism. By utilizing next-generation sequencing technology, we provide unparalleled accuracy in detecting genetic mutations associated with multiple acyl-CoA dehydrogenase deficiency (MADD), a rare but serious metabolic disorder affecting energy production from fats.

Who Should Consider This Test
This genetic test is particularly recommended for individuals presenting with:
- Unexplained metabolic crises or acidotic episodes
- Recurrent hypoglycemia without apparent cause
- Muscle weakness, fatigue, or exercise intolerance
- Developmental delays in infants and children
- Family history of metabolic disorders
- Unexplained liver dysfunction or hepatomegaly
- Cardiomyopathy or cardiac abnormalities
- Feeding difficulties in newborns

Understanding Your Test Results
Our genetic specialists provide detailed interpretation of your results:
- Positive Result: Indicates the presence of pathogenic ETFB gene mutations. Our genetic counselors will explain the implications and recommend appropriate management strategies.
- Negative Result: Suggests no detectable mutations in the ETFB gene, though other genetic factors may still be considered.
- Variant of Uncertain Significance: Some genetic changes may require additional family studies for complete interpretation.
- Carrier Status: Identifies individuals who carry one copy of a mutated gene but typically don’t show symptoms.
